Expect the unexpected when you experiment with different speeds on the pottery wheel. What new shapes and proportions can emerge?

 

Prepare the clay, and centre it on the pottery wheel, establishing a stable foundation for the form. From there, open the clay, and define its base before gradually pulling up the walls to control height and thickness. Focus on balancing pressure between your hands and guiding the movement to maintain the form as it rotates.

 

Experiment with changes in wheel speed, and allow for different transformations to occur. Respond by reshaping the form, refining its rim and adjusting its proportions. Restore balance without erasing the traces of movement that emerged during the process.

 

Complete your work through trimming, drying and firing, and think about the interplay between control and unpredictability during the process.
